  2. I am thinking about setting an Admin password for the UEFI firmware settings.
    Is this really required?

    BitLocker full drive encryption is enabled.


    I have Secure Boot enabled, but what if my laptop gets stolen and someone can change the UEFI settings?


    .So can I create the UEFI Admin password to be the same as my OS Admin password?
    Would this pose an issue? My passwords are very complex.

    Its very surprising to me that in most of security related forums out there, setting a UEFI Admin password is off the radar and not talked about so much...

    Problem is if you set a password and forget it, you are screwed and may have to resort to elaborate physical methods to reset bios.

    There is no real need to use a bios password unless you want to prevent users with PHYSICAL access to pc to change anything.

    Remote users/hackers cannot modify the bios.

    I guess it helps if laptop is stolen but even then most thieves would wipe drives anyway. You should not keep confidential details on a laptop if risk of theft is high where you take it.

  7. There's no real benefit of a UEFI admin password, which just prevents people from modifying your UEFI settings, if you are concerned about physical theft.

    Secure Boot protects against attackers from modifying your OS boot files and surreptitiously installing malware or disabling OS protections. It's not even required for BitLocker, which uses a separate mechanism to validate the bootloader.

    If someone steals your laptop then BitLocker (preferably with a PIN) is sufficient to protect your data.
